## Env Vars: Upstream Breaker (Mallowgate API)

Breaker config for the Mallowgate upstream lives in the release env file. `BREAKER_FAIL_MAX=5`, `BREAKER_RESET_SEC=30`. Do not change per-release without sign-off. Rollbacks must carry the same values or the breaker state desyncs across pods. The breaker control plane requires an auth token, which the env file sets on the following line.

secret setting of hawep-yahig: LEDGER_TOKEN29=41b5d6315371c92885eaeb077fb63

While reviewing the Harrowlink gateway fleet, I found three combine-harvester edge nodes running stale settings from the pre-harvest rollout. The drift affects upload cadence and retry backoff, which explains the duplicate telemetry rows Priya flagged last sprint. I've reconciled the nodes against the canonical manifest and verified checksums on each. Please confirm the reconciliation logic handles nested overrides correctly. For reference, the canonical values the fleet should converge to are listed below.

config for kagup-hahig:
druwyn:
  pin: 2801
  metrics_host: metrics.druwyn.zemvarlabs.internal
  tenant: sorius
  seal: seal_798a43d7

## Cold starts — Pelora handlers

Customers reporting slow first responses are usually hitting cold starts on the Pelora serverless tier. Handlers idle out after the configured window and the next invocation pays init cost, typically two to four seconds. Support can confirm by checking the init-duration field in the invocation log. Mitigation is pre-warming, which ops can enable per handler; it is already on for checkout flows. The warm-pool and timeout settings currently in effect are shown below.

service settings:
PRAIX_LOG_LEVEL=error
PRAIX_METRICS_HOST=metrics.praix.qorvelcorp.corp
PRAIX_POOL_SIZE=16

Ticket: StreamVault — replica-lag alarm bundle fails signature check

The alert bundle for the read-replica lag alarm is rejected by the verifier after last week's pipeline change. Root cause: the bundle was signed before the rotation, so the old fingerprint no longer matches. Please review the re-signing patch and confirm it references the key below.

signing key of fajop-tahop = bky9_qdL6xeDv7